30-minute Tortellini Soup
  1. In a large pot or Dutch oven, heat the oil over medium heat. Once shimmering, add the onion, carrots, and celery and cook until softened, 5 to 7 minutes.

  2. Add the garlic, Italian seasoning, crushed red pepper flakes, and a pinch of salt and pepper. Cook for 1 minute, or until you begin to smell the garlic and spices.

  3. Add the chicken stock, Parmesan rind (if using), and a generous pinch of salt and pepper, and bring to a boil.

  4. Reduce the heat to a simmer and cook for about 15 to 20 minutes.

  5. Add the tortellini and cook according to the package directions until al dente.

  6. Remove the Parmesan rind and check the soup for seasoning, adding more salt and pepper as needed.
